> When using an IssuedToken assertion, location information about the STS in 
> the assertion is ignored and instead must be entirely manually configured.
> It is convenient for consumers to be able to request tokens with minimal 
> additional configuration.  If providers embed sufficient information in the 
> WS-A EPR (Issuer element) of the IssuedToken assertion, sufficient 
> information exists in the policy document to configure the STS client.  The 
> option to supplement or override this information using the Configurable 
> mechanism currently supported provides consumers with the greatest 
> flexibility.
> Alternatively, if the policy specifies an IssuerName, this name could be used 
> to perform the lookup of the bean under the Configurable framework.
> If these two elements are omitted, then falling back to the existing 
> configuration mechanism would be supported.
> The ultimate order for applying configurations and the application of some or 
> all configuration patterns remains to be considered.
